![]() My name is Brian McNaught. I'm an educator on the issues facing gay, lesbian, bisexual, and transgender people. I do so through my books, video tapes, DVDs, and public presentations. Since 1974, I've been working primarily with predominantly heterosexual audiences in corporate and college settings helping people to better understand the unique challenges and opportunities faced by gay people to acknowledge, affirm, and integrate our sexual orientation into our family, faith, and work communities. My experience underscores that anyone can be an ally, and that building bridges of mutual respect requires putting a face on the issue. A nun, an "ex-gay" man, and a cross-dressing heterosexual church organist arrive in Cazenovia, NY, on a hot Saturday in July and there meet a "queer" activist, a homophobic Planned Parenthood educator, a hunky straight man in a wheelchair, two football coaches, and a half a dozen ministers, among others. In the next few days, under the watchful guidance of the staff, these fictionalized characters, all based on the stories of real life participants, identify for themselves and the others the five events in their lives that have most impacted their sexuality. |
